Here in Guilderland, New York, situated just a stone's throw from Albany, we have a thriving and diverse nursing job market that offers a unique blend of opportunity and community charm. Guilderland boasts a suburban feel with lush parks and easy access to the beautiful Albany Pine Bush, which makes it not only a wonderful place to work but also a delightful place to live. According to recent U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ics data, the annual mean wage for nurses in New York is about $81,100, while the median hourly wage is approximately $35.58. In Guilderland specifically, our estimated salary range for registered nurses can average between $80,000 and $85,000 annually, which is slightly above the national average of $77,600 while still remaining competitive with nearby Albany where the demand helps keep salaries in a similar range. The nursing job market in Guilderland is robust, with steady growth forecasted over the next 3-5 years. NurseRecruiter estimates that the area will need approximately 200 new nurses as healthcare demands rise due to an aging population. Currently, Guilderland has about 1,400 nurses employed, reflecting a diverse supply catering to various healthcare settings such as Albany Medical Center, St. Peter's Hospital, and smaller clinics around town. Travel nursing positions, while fewer compared to larger urban areas, still have relevance here, particularly during peak flu season in the fall and winter months when temporary staffing needs spike. The per diem market offers enriching flex work opportunities with numerous local facilities needing coverage. When contrasting Guilderland with nearby cities like Albany, Schenectady, and Troy, the differences become more noticeable; Albany, with its larger healthcare facilities, tends to offer greater job opportunities but not always at significantly higher salaries.
